Properties of Tungsten Carbide
To understand why tungsten carbide is the preferred material for deburring applications, you need to recognize its remarkable properties. This alloy, composed of tungsten and carbon, is engineered for exceptional performance. Its chemical structure provides superior hardness, making it an excellent choice for cutting and shaping metals, while also allowing for precision in intricate deburring tasks. You will find that these properties significantly enhance your efficiency and effectiveness in machining operations.
Hardness and Durability
After exploring tungsten carbide’s composition, you will appreciate its unparalleled hardness and durability. This material boasts a hardness rating of around 8.5 to 9 on the Mohs scale, making it one of the hardest substances known. This hardness allows you to tackle tough and abrasive materials without compromising the tool’s integrity, ultimately reducing the frequency of tool replacements and maintenance.
Resistance to Wear and Tear
By utilizing tungsten carbide for your deburring applications, you gain the advantage of exceptional resistance to wear and tear. This characteristic allows the tools to withstand extensive usage without significant degradation over time, ensuring you enjoy consistent performance.
Resistance to wear and tear is vital in maintaining productivity in your operations. Tungsten carbide has a remarkable ability to resist abrasion, which means that it can endure the stresses of repetitive contact with various materials. This durability translates into longer tool life, ultimately saving you both time and money on replacements. Furthermore, the consistent performance of tungsten carbide tools allows you to achieve a smoother finish, reducing the need for rework and enhancing the overall quality of your projects.

Comparison with Other Materials
You might wonder how tungsten carbide burs stack up against other materials used in deburring applications. Below is a quick comparison to help you assess their performance and suitability for your projects.
| Material | Characteristics |
|---|---|
| Tungsten Carbide | High durability, excellent wear resistance, effective for a variety of materials. |
| High-Speed Steel | Good toughness, but wears down faster compared to tungsten carbide. |
| Diamond Burs | Superior hardness, expert for fine detailing, but more expensive and can chip. |
Tungsten Carbide vs. High-Speed Steel
About high-speed steel burs; they are known for their toughness and affordability but tend to wear down quicker than tungsten carbide. This means that while they might be a cost-effective choice initially, you may find yourself replacing them more often, potentially increasing your long-term costs.
Tungsten Carbide vs. Diamond Burs
After examining diamond burs, you will notice that they offer superior hardness, making them ideal for fine detailing work. However, they can also be more expensive and are prone to chipping when used against tougher materials. In contrast, tungsten carbide provides a more balanced option, excelling in durability while remaining cost-effective.
Steel diamond burs shine in applications requiring precision but may not hold up against harder materials over time. Tungsten carbide burs, on the other hand, maintain their sharpness longer and withstand a wider range of tasks without compromising the quality of your work. For consistent performance, the versatility of tungsten carbide makes it a preferred choice in most deburring scenarios. Maintenance and Care of Tungsten Carbide Burs
Despite the durability of tungsten carbide burs, proper maintenance and care are crucial to ensure their longevity and performance. Regularly inspecting your burs for wear, maintaining cleanliness, and storing them appropriately can maximize their efficiency in deburring applications. Investing time in these practices will enhance your cutting precision and overall workflow, allowing you to achieve the best results in your projects.
Cleaning Techniques
Across various industries, maintaining cleanliness is vital for sustaining the effectiveness of your tungsten carbide burs. To clean them, you can use a brush or compressed air to remove debris and buildup after each use. Additionally, soaking them in a mild solvent can help eliminate more stubborn residues, thereby improving their performance during the next operation.
Proper Storage Methods
Among the key considerations for extending the lifespan of your tungsten carbide burs is employing proper storage methods. Keeping your burs in a designated, organized storage container will prevent them from being damaged or dulling prematurely.
Also, consider using a padded case or a magnetic holder to protect the burs from impacts and collisions with other tools. Ensure that they are stored in a clean and dry environment, as moisture can lead to rust or corrosion. By following these best practices for storage, you can keep your tungsten carbide burs in optimal condition, ready for your next deburring task.
Choosing the Right Tungsten Carbide Bur
Your choice of tungsten carbide bur can significantly impact the efficiency of your deburring tasks. Consider the material you’ll be working with, the specific surface finish you desire, and the scale of your project. Selecting the appropriate bur ensures a smoother process, minimizes wear on your tools, and enhances the overall quality of your work.
Bur Shapes and Sizes
After evaluating your project requirements, you’ll need to determine the right bur shapes and sizes. Different shapes offer distinct benefits, such as pointed tips for precision work or larger heads for aggressive material removal. The size should align with the intricacies of your task, allowing you to navigate tight spaces or cover larger areas efficiently.
Considerations for Specific Tasks
Tungsten carbide burs are versatile but tailored choices can elevate your results. Each bur is designed with specific applications in mind, from smoothing edges to shaping contours. Understanding the task at hand will help you select the best bur to achieve optimal results quickly and effectively.
With a keen awareness of the job requirements, you can select burs that cater to specific materials and deburring techniques. For instance, harder materials might necessitate larger, more robust burs, while intricate designs benefit from finer, more detailed shapes. Additionally, if you’re working on a project that demands a high finish quality, choosing the appropriate bur will ensure minimized rework and a polished final product.
